What Is NAD+?

NAD+ is a coenzyme found in every cell of your body. It exists in two forms — NAD+ (oxidized) and NADH (reduced) — and shuttles electrons between these forms during cellular metabolism. This electron transfer is fundamental to:

  • Glycolysis and the citric acid cycle (how cells burn glucose for energy)
  • The electron transport chain (mitochondrial ATP production)
  • Sirtuin enzyme activation (SIRT1–SIRT7, which regulate aging, inflammation, and metabolism)
  • PARP enzymes (DNA damage detection and repair)
  • CD38 enzyme activity (immune cell regulation)

By age 40–50, NAD+ levels in most adults are half what they were at age 20. This decline is accelerated by chronic stress, alcohol consumption, poor diet, and chronic illness. IV NAD+ therapy rapidly replenishes these depleted stores.

NAD+ IV Therapy Benefits

Cellular Energy (ATP Production)

NAD+ is the rate-limiting factor in mitochondrial energy production. Restoring NAD+ levels directly increases cellular ATP output, which patients experience as sustained energy — not the stimulant buzz of caffeine, but a cleaner, deeper vitality that improves over multiple sessions.

DNA Repair

PARP enzymes that detect and repair DNA damage are completely dependent on NAD+ as a substrate. Higher NAD+ availability means faster, more efficient DNA repair — reducing the accumulation of DNA damage that underlies aging and cancer risk.

Anti-Aging via Sirtuin Activation

Sirtuins are NAD+-dependent enzymes that regulate gene expression, inflammation, mitochondrial biogenesis, and metabolic homeostasis. Research by Dr. David Sinclair and others has established sirtuins as central regulators of aging. Raising NAD+ activates these longevity pathways.

Cognitive Clarity

The brain consumes 20% of the body's energy despite being 2% of body mass. NAD+ supports neuronal mitochondrial function and is required for neurotransmitter synthesis. Many patients report significant improvements in mental sharpness, memory recall, and mood within days of their first NAD+ series.

NAD+ IV Side Effects

NAD+ produces more during-infusion side effects than other IV drips. These are well-known, manageable, and temporary — but patients should be prepared for them. They are caused by rapid cellular metabolic activation.

Common During-Infusion Effects

  • Flushing or warmth throughout the body
  • Chest tightness or mild pressure (not cardiac)
  • Nausea or stomach cramping
  • Light-headedness or dizziness
  • Muscle cramping
  • Fatigue or heaviness

All managed by slowing the infusion rate. Inform your nurse immediately if side effects are uncomfortable.

Rare but Serious Effects

  • Significant drop in blood pressure
  • Severe allergic reaction (anaphylaxis — extremely rare)
  • Phlebitis at IV site
  • Severe nausea requiring anti-nausea medication

NAD+ should always be administered by a licensed RN in a setting equipped to manage adverse reactions.

NAD+ infusions are among the slowest IV drips because infusing too quickly causes significant side effects (chest tightness, flushing, nausea). A typical NAD+ IV session takes 60–90 minutes for a standard 250–500 mg dose. Higher dose sessions (750 mg–1,000 mg) for anti-aging or addiction recovery protocols can take 2–4 hours. The drip rate is carefully managed by the administering nurse.
